纳米微粒对低温保护剂溶液玻璃化性质的影响

摘    要:利用差示扫描量热仪(DSC)研究了加入羟基磷灰石(HA)纳米微粒对低温保护剂溶液玻璃化的影响,实验得到了不同粒径和不同质量浓度的HA纳米微粒加入PVP溶液的玻璃化转变温度与反玻璃化温度.实验结果表明加入纳米微粒能显著的影响低温保护剂溶液的玻璃化性质.且随着纳米微粒质量分数的增加,溶液的玻璃化转变温度与反玻璃化温度均显著...

Abstract:In order to investigate the effects of Nanoparticles on the vitrification of Cryprotective agent solutions at cryogenic temperatures,the vitrification and devitrification temperature of these solutions with different particle size and concentrations of HA nanoparticles were measured by differential scanning calorimeter (DSC).Experimental results indicate that the vitrification can be significantly affected by nanoparticles.And with the mass fraction of nanometer particles increasing,the vitrification and de...
